Transaction 3b58e112245e13b132bf32df4cd6700133568f291faee3b1080ff1eda0ba5d9f
3 Input
2 Outputs
- 3b58e112245e13b132bf32df4cd6700133568f291faee3b1080ff1eda0ba5d9f:0
- 3b58e112245e13b132bf32df4cd6700133568f291faee3b1080ff1eda0ba5d9f:1
value 34000000
address 16bJToTnAtTfC8nnbrFS4Zvwa5BTBgJSWT
value 70248326
address 1P4pTiE4zmCUzrr53EMxwzcYwjPnZQd76e